TP钱包转账矿工费不足——原因、修复与未来技术展望

概述:

当在TP(TokenPocket)钱包发起链上转账却提示“矿工费不足”(gas不够)时,用户常感困惑。本文从原因排查、即时解决、安全认证、技术前景、市场动态、高性能实现到Golang与身份隐私角度给出全面说明与建议。

一、常见原因与即时解决方法:

1) 选择了错误的网络或链(如ERC-20在BSC上)导致费估算错误。确认目标链与代币所属链一致。

2) Gas Price/Max Fee设置过低或网络拥堵(EIP-1559后需设置maxFeePerGas和maxPriorityFeePerGas)。提高费用或选择加速/重发交易(replace-by-fee)。

3) 非cex交易需足够ETH或主链代币支付手续费,检查主代币余额而非仅代币余额。

4) 交易nonce冲突或丢失:查看历史nonce,若卡住可发送nonce相同但更高矿工费的替换交易或使用取消交易。

5) 钱包版本或节点服务异常:尝试切换节点、刷新交易池或升级TP钱包。

二、安全认证与防护:

- 私钥与助记词:任何修复操作前务必确保私钥/助记词安全,不在不受信任设备上输入;优先使用硬件签名设备。

- 签名请求审查:核对转账地址、链ID和Gas参数,警惕伪造界面或弹窗。

- 多重认证:TP等钱包对于高风险操作建议结合硬件钱包、冷钱包或手机生物认证。

- 后端节点可信:避免使用来路不明的轻客户端/第三方节点,防止中间人篡改fee建议。

三、新兴技术前景(缓解用户付费负担):

- 元交易(meta-transactions)与Paymaster模式使第三方代付手续费成为可能,配合ERC-2771或ERC-4337(账户抽象)能实现更友好的“免gas”体验。

- Layer2(Optimistic、ZK-rollups)和侧链能大幅降低手续费与提高吞吐,适合小额频繁转账。

- Gas代币、闪电结算和Gas抽象机制在不断演进,但仍需平衡安全与复杂性。

四、市场动态与高效能市场技术:

- Gas价格高度依赖网络活动(DeFi策略、NFT铸造、空投等),高峰期手续费剧增。

- MEV(最大可提取价值)和区块订序器的兴起影响交易被打包优先级:高出价交易优先被包含,用户可通过专门服务或Flashbots等通道避免被夹击或前置。

- 高性能撮合与低延迟节点、专用Sequencer和批量交易技术对减少单笔费用、提高吞吐有显著作用。

五、Golang在钱包与节点开发的角色:

- go-ethereum(geth)是主流节点实现,Golang擅长高并发网络编程,适合实现轻节点、交易池管理、gas估算和RPC服务。

- 钱包后端常用Golang处理签名请求、nonce管理、重试逻辑、替换交易与费用策略。推荐实践:使用成熟的secp256k1库、严格的RPC重试与超时策略、并发安全的nonce队列与交易缓存。

六、身份与隐私考量:

- 身份:去中心化身份(DID)和可验证凭证能帮助在合规场景下绑定链上操作与真实身份。

- 隐私:zk-SNARKs/zk-STARKs、混币(mixer)、盲签名等技术可在一定场景下保护交易隐私,但伴随合规与监管风险。

- 权衡:提高隐私常伴随可审计性下降,项目需根据业务场景选择合规与隐私的平衡点。

七、实用建议总结:

- 先检查主链代币余额、链选择与nonce;如因费用不足可提高maxFee/maxPriority或使用替换交易。

- 使用硬件钱包与受信节点,谨慎输入助记词。

- 关注Layer2和元交易服务以降低长期费用。

- 对开发者:用Golang实现稳健的fee估算、retry与nonce管理,监控mempool与链上波动。

结语:

TP钱包提示矿工费不足通常是可诊断与可修复的问题,用户在即时操作之外应重视安全认证与隐私保护。未来账户抽象、元交易与Layer2将使用户体验更好,但技术演进也带来新的安全与合规挑战。保持软件更新、谨慎签名与选择可靠服务,是当前最稳妥的做法。

作者:林亦辰发布时间:2026-01-21 18:18:30

评论

CryptoCat

文章讲得很全面,特别是对nonce冲突和替换交易的说明,实操性很强。

张小明

感谢,解决了我以为没ETH却只看到代币的困惑,原来要看主链代币余额。

SatoshiFan

关于Golang的部分很有价值,想知道有没有推荐的secp256k1库和并发nonce实现示例?

梁雨

对元交易和Paymaster的介绍让我看到未来“免gas”体验的希望,但也担心合规问题。

相关阅读